Few existing data on the history of the Indians who inhabited the ancient lands of Onzaga. Oral tradition stories that have come up today Onzaga state that the word is derived from a chief named Hunzaa, whose term Spanish name derived Onzaga.

Before the conquest, the chief of Onzaga taxed him at least twenty-four blankets and food captains. In turn, he and his Indians were subject to Tundama, the great chief of Duitama, and offered blankets, cassava, sweet potatoes, etc.
